This is a photo of my new ishi with a window. The hole will allow me to remove antler if it gets stuck or too short to pull. Slugs are added to raise the antler bit as it shortens due to wear.
-
Good idea on that. If it still gets stuck - drill a small hole in the antler from the tip and put a drywall screw in that and pull it out with pliers (not very "abo" however).
